High cycle fatigue of electrical-discharge machined AISI D2 tool steel

摘要

An analysis of electrical-discharge machined AISI D2 tool steel for high-cycle fatigue is conducted. The damage model was developed to reveal the influence of different electrical-discharge machining conditions on the fatigue life. The processed surface layer and the cross-section were examined by scanning electron microscopy(SEM). The experimental results show that the fatigue life of the EDMed specimens is shorter than the mechanically polished samples.
